That's basically because in Hollywood if you want to use US Military assets (ie Tanks and Helicopters), the Department of Defense has to look over the script and approve of the film's portrayal of the US Military and will add stuff to make the movie a recruitment tool.

I mean ID4 2 has online advertisements about you joining the Earth Defense forces that lead you to Army/Navy/Air Force recruitment sites.
